Search jobs > Seattle, WA > Internship > Sr software engineer

Sr Software Development Engineer, AWS Open Data Analytics Engines

Amazon
Seattle, Washington, US
Full-time

Sr Software Development Engineer, AWS Open Data Analytics Engines

Job ID : 2811734 Amazon Development Center U.S., Inc.

The analytics team is looking for an experienced engineer to join the core engines team.

In order to make an application, simply read through the following job description and make sure to attach relevant documents.

Athena and EMR are services that our customers use to run large scale analytics, leveraging open source engines like Trino and Spark.

The analytic engine organization makes significant modifications to these engines to run in serverless environments and with superior performance and scalability than what is available in Open Source.

In the last 3 years we have improved our engines by a factor of 5x by making changes to the optimizer, query runtime and storage connectors.

We have also made significant changes to the compiler to enable enterprise features like fine grain access control. This is a must-win strategic area in a growing and very technical space.

We are looking for a hands-on engineer to help us improve the engine further. As a Sr Engineer on the engines team, you will help with direction, design and implementation of key areas and mentor the next set of engineers.

Key job responsibilities :

  • Hands-on development for core components of the query engine
  • Design and develop solutions and algorithms to improve performance of Spark and / or Trino
  • Interact and partner in the open source community
  • Ensure data consistency and durability with breakthrough performance and scalability
  • Improve the organization's automation and testing capabilities
  • Manage complex deliverables project and research projects with deadlines
  • Mentor and train other team members on design techniques and engine good practices
  • Be a point of contact for challenging customer issues around query engine problems

BASIC QUALIFICATIONS

  • 5+ years of non-internship professional software development experience
  • 5+ years of programming with at least one software programming language experience
  • 5+ years of leading design or architecture (design patterns, reliability and scaling) of new and existing systems experience
  • Experience as a mentor, tech lead or leading an engineering team

PREFERRED QUALIFICATIONS

  • 5+ years of full software development life cycle, including coding standards, code reviews, source control management, build processes, testing, and operations experience
  • Bachelor's degree in computer science or equivalent

Amazon is committed to a diverse and inclusive workplace. Amazon is an equal opportunity employer and does not discriminate on the basis of race, national origin, gender, gender identity, sexual orientation, protected veteran status, disability, age, or other legally protected status.

J-18808-Ljbffr

1 day ago
Related jobs
Promoted
Amazon
Seattle, Washington

Software Development Engineer - AWS Identity & Access Management, AWS Identity. AWS has the most services and more features within those services than any other cloud provider–from infrastructure technologies like compute, storage, and databases–to emerging technologies, such as machine learning...

Amazon.com Services LLC
Seattle, Washington

AWS Financial Technology Team is looking for a results-oriented, innovative software development engineer, who can help us create the next generation of distributed, scalable financial data platform. AWS Fintech Data Platform Team powers 30+ AWS Fintech data heavy applications across reporting of fi...

Amazon Data Services, Inc.
Kirkland, Washington

These are core systems development positions where you will own the design and development of significant software components critical to our industry leading database services architect-ed for the cloud. The Incident Prevention team is looking for experienced software engineers who are excited abou...

Amazon Web Services, Inc.
Bothell, Washington

The AWS Managed Services (AMS) development team is looking for an exceptional Sr Software Development Engineer to join our team, tasked with developing and evolving feature capabilities that enable accelerated adoption of AWS services for enterprise customers. Knowledge of professional software engi...

Promoted
Edjuster
Redmond, Washington

Microsoft is considered one of the leaders in Software as a Service in the world of business applications and this organization is at the heart of how business applications are designed and delivered, we're looking for a Sr. Software Engineer to join our team!. Microsoft Dataverse is the platform to...

Promoted
Nytec, Inc.
Kirkland, Washington

Software Engineer - Bluetooth, Python. Title: Software Engineer (Bluetooth). Nytec’s world-class designers, engineers, and manufacturing experts translate complex problems into compelling, simple solutions that deliver the ultimate user experience. Nytec manages client projects end-to-end at their P...

Promoted
Amazon
Seattle, Washington

We are open to hiring candidates to work out of one of the following locations:. Experience programming with at least one software programming language. ...

Amazon Development Center U.S., Inc.
Seattle, Washington

Mentor junior software development engineers. EBS is growing as the amount of data used by businesses that run on AWS continues to increase. This is a foundational AWS service on which most other AWS services depend. Being at the heart of much of what AWS does presents numerous opportunities for gro...

Promoted
Amazon
Seattle, Washington

Collaborate closely with a multidisciplinary team, including Software Development Engineers (SDEs), Product Managers (PMs), Technical Program Managers (TPMs), and Software Development Managers (SDMs) to craft and deliver top-notch technology solutions. As a Software Development Engineer (SDE II) wit...

Amazon.com Services LLC
Seattle, Washington

With Amazon Kinesis Data Streams, customers process gigabytes per second of real-time user engagement data for gaming and marketing analytics, build real-time IoT sensor data analytics solutions, analyze millions of financial transactions in real time, perform network intrusion detection for securit...